Sioux City Journal
14 February 2006

DANBURY, Iowa -- Alma Loretto McBride, 105, of Battle Creek, Iowa, formerly of Danbury, passed away Sunday, Feb. 12, 2006, at Willow Dale Wellness Village in Battle Creek.

Services will be 11 a.m. today at St. Mary's Catholic Church in Danbury, with the Rev. Terry Roder officiating. Burial will be in St. Mary's Catholic Cemetery. Visitation will be 9 a.m. until service time at the church. Arrangements are under the direction of Barker Funeral Home in Holstein, Iowa.

Alma was born May 8, 1900, the daughter of Albert and Margaret (Smith) McBride, on the family farm northeast of Danbury. She received her education in Danbury, graduating from St. Patrick's Academy in 1918. She furthered her education at the University of Wyoming in Laramie. She went on to teach in Nebraska, Wyoming and Nevada. She retired in Henderson, Nev., in 1965, and returned to Danbury in 1991. She entered Willow Dale Wellness Village in August 2001.

She was a member of St. Mary's Parish in Danbury.

She is survived by many n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her parents; three brothers, Wilfred, her twin, Albert "Toby" and Walter "Spec"; and two sisters, Florence and Elizabeth "Sister Theresa."
